Claire began the session by unpacking how our stress response is energy-hungry. Every thought, deadline, and meeting demands something from our internal battery – and without conscious replenishment, those reserves quickly run low. She explored how we can intentionally build daily practices that restore balance, regulate the nervous system, and keep us grounded even when life gets busy.
Attendees were guided through simple, practical tools to use throughout the day – from “micromoments” of calm and mindful breathing to posture resets and short breaks that allow the brain to recharge. Claire also discussed the power of quality sleep, reminding us that rest isn’t a luxury but a key part of performance and emotional resilience.
